    I cannot login and authorize my pinterest. Everything else works fine but it says: Sign up failed. Please check your login. I have even changed the password to try to enter through your app and it will not work. Also your support email is not working.
    I did everything you asked on this forum topic:
    https://ww.wp.xz.cn/support/topic/unable-to-connect-with-pinterest/
    I cleared cache, logged out, have no connections to pinterest from blog2social. i used incognito window and logged in fine. I also cleared my cache again. I typed every word, I didn’t copy or paste. Please help me. i tried emailing you but the email gets returned:

    Address not found
    Your message wasn’t delivered to [email protected] because the address couldn’t be found, or is unable to receive mail.
    The response from the remote server was:

    550 Address invalid (ID:550:1:1 (mi027.mc1.hosteurope.de))

    Please help me. I would love to buy the premium service but if I can’t get pinterest to work its not work it for me. Also your support form on your website isn’t working correctly, I tried submitting a ticket but it didn’t work.

    Thank you for the information, @dessar_sega and @emdeewee.

    Pinterest is working on their login routine to limit and stop spammers. In very rare cases this can impact users who don’t do anything wrong when trying to authorize their Pinterest account for third party tools.

    This is why there might appear temporary interferences when accessing Pinterest. You can find more information about this topic here: https://help.pinterest.com/en/article/cant-log-in-because-of-suspicious-activity .

    As soon as authorizing your Pinterest account in Blog2Social works in a stable way again, I will let you know.
